hello,

i want to show a module on the left panel, on a page which doesn't have the itemid in the URL, the reason for not having itemid is that this page is generated by a thrid party component (hotproperty from mossets) and this page is the property details which has the URL like

option=com_hotproperty&view=property&id=18 (for property details)
option=com_hotproperty&view=type&id=18 (for property list).

another issue is, i want to show a menu module on left panel of my child site (loading a particular category of hotproperty component in frameset, from the parent site).

This child site is being loaded in frameset and it loads a part of my parent site, i want a couple of menu to be shown only for this Child site.

anyone out there to help please? is this possible in joomla?

let me also tell you that, i tried the module mod onanypage but it doesnt allow me for what i'm looking for.
